Rooftop MMS & PV Installation
Install the Module Mounting Structure (MMS) and PV modules as per design,
including accessories such as end clamps, mid clamps, earthing clips, etc.
Perform proper DC cable stringing and cable management under the PV panels,
ensuring that MC4 connectors and DC cables are not exposed to direct sunlight.
Ensure the DC cables follow the approved bending radius and are securely
fastened with heavy-duty cable ties.
Conduct torqueing and marking with oil marker for MMS and accessories.

Trunking and Cabling for Drain, Road Crossings, and UGC Installation
Ensure Compliance with Design and Specifications: Verify that the trunking is
sized and installed according to the approved design and relevant specifications
Proper Trunking Angles: Install trunking with a 45-degree angle at bends,
avoiding 90-degree angles, as sharp bends can cause stress and potential
damage to the cable
Support System Installation: Provide appropriate support for the trunking to
maintain alignment and integrity. Ensure that the support system is corrosion-
resistant and capable of withstanding environmental conditions.
Earthing Requirements: Implement proper earthing for the trunking system as
per the applicable electrical standards to ensure safety and prevent potential
electrical hazards.
Seal Trunking Openings: Properly seal any openings or holes in the trunking to
maintain the integrity of the system and prevent any ingress of moisture or
foreign materials.
Drainage Crossing (Under or Through): When crossing drainage systems,
ensure the trunking is either routed under or through the drain. If crossing
through the drain, utilize galvanized iron (GI) pipes for additional protection.
Ensure the drainage system is fully restored to its original condition upon
completion of works.
Road Crossing Requirements: For road crossings, use PN10 pipes with
appropriate PVC slabs for protection. Ensure the installation is carried out as per
the specified standards, including the use of PVC slabs, sand, and crusher run
for backfilling. Upon completion, ensure the road surface is restored to its original
state, minimizing any disruption to traffic or structural integrity.
Underground Cable Installation: Use PN10 or HDPE pipes for cable protection.
Maintain a gap between power and communication cables to avoid interference.
Backfill with PVC slabs, sand, and crusher run, ensuring the surface is properly
restored.
Cable Markers:Install cable markers every 10 meters and at all corners or
changes in direction. Ensure markers are visible and securely positioned for
easy identification during future maintenance.
Testing & Commisioning works
Site testing & commissioning test of PV systems as per IEC 62446, MS
1837:2010, SEDA and other relevant IEC standards.
Earth continuity test
Earth resistance test
AC-DC cable insulation resistance (IR) test
LV AC cable insulation resistance (IR) test
PV array (DC) open-circuit voltage & short-circuit current test
PV array (DC) MPP voltage & MPP current test
Inverter anti-islanding test
PV system acceptance test
